It is another stunning day here in Newcomb Bay. Loading of Return to Australia (RTA) cargo has continued. It is nearly finished. We estimate we should finish up either late this evening or sometime tomorrow morning, at which point we will depart for Hobart.
All returning expeditioners are making their way back to the ship. Some have already returned, one has departed to remain at Casey for the summer, and we have some newcomers joining us for the return voyage.
